An engineer with proper knowledge about management is very much necessary for improving the efficiency of production line and eliminating waste from the entire production chain for enhancing productivity of the company.1.2 Definition of terms1.2.1 Talk time: time needed to perform a given task normally expressed in minutes. It is a pre-requisite in balancing tasks. Talk time marges production with customer’ demands. Producing faster than talk time causes over production whereas producing slower than talk time creates bottlenecks (Elbert, 2013).1.2.3 Bottleneck: delayed transmission in production process.1.2.4 Productivity: output ratio verses input. It is determined by worker’s skills, technology, andmachinery. 1.2.5 Workstation: a place set aside for specific work with tools and equipment.1.2.6 Downtime: a period when no value is added to production. It is associated with wastessuch as overproduction, long waiting period, transportation, and inappropriate processing.
